TO COVER THIS SEASON, Young Tom of Lincoln, T ATE the property of, and bred by Mr. C. J-i Smith, of Sydney ; now belonging to Edward Constable^ of Kent Place, Eden Valley. He was got by that well known horse ; "Tom of Lincoln," imported to Sydney by Mr. Smith, in 1835, and out of a pure Clydes dale Mare. " Young Tom,'' is «even years old, beautiful black, fine symmetry, and bone; and has proved himself a good worker, and sure foal getter. Terms,— Two Guineas, to be paid before the Mare is stinted. N.B. Good English grass paddocks for Mares on reasonable terms.
